Before making any purchase with a new online retailer, take the time to read the terms and conditions and their site privacy policy. You want to find out how they protect your information, what details they will require and what terms you are agreeing to if you make a purchase from them. If you disagree with these policies, talk to the merchant first. If you do not agree with their policies, do not buy from them.

Be sure to comparison shop when you shop online. That way you can get the best prices. It can be quite easy to find just what you want at the right price online. Just keep in mind that you want to be dealing with a trustworthy seller no matter what price you end up paying. Even though the price is low, this doesn't matter if you prefer not to order from them.

If you want to be a smart and safe online shopper, never go looking for a deal unless your anti-virus and anti-malware programs are fully up-to-date. Large retailers are often the target of hackers and others unscrupulous people that will try to steal all your personal information. Heed warnings from security software about some sites and reports of suspicious activity from a site's webmaster.

If you frequently shop at an online store, you should consider registering with them. This will save you time checking out, and you may also be offered discounts from time to time. You might be able to receive email deals that other site guests do not receive. This is also helpful for keeping track of orders, problems and returns.

Proceed with extreme caution when volunteering your personal information to an unfamiliar online retailer. Become familiar with security symbols such as Cybertrust or Verisign to help decide if a website is legitimate and concerned with your security.

Check out online coupon and deals sites before shopping online. You can find coupons for manufacturers and retailers alike, all of which can save you great amounts of money. However, to obtain these great coupons, you must ensure you search for these coupons prior to shopping.

Many online retailers build customer loyalty by offering coupon codes to people who subscribe to their internet newsletters. You can register for newsletters or like their Facebook page in a matter of seconds, and by doing these things, you can quickly obtain valuable information on deals.
